The 2001 Peugeot 106 passes its MOT first time only 69.6% of the time, well below the UK average of 80%, and one in four of these cars have recorded a dangerous defect at some point—a significant concern for prospective buyers. Petrol and diesel variants perform identically, both struggling equally with the test.
At around 64,000 miles median mileage, these 23-year-old cars are running relatively low, yet they average 4.29 failures and 10.4 advisories per test, suggesting wear issues are catching up despite modest use. Before buying, get a pre-purchase inspection focused on structural corrosion and brake condition, as these older Peugeots are prone to rust and deterioration that MOT testers frequently flag.

Pass Rate by Fuel Type
| Fuel type | Vehicles | Pass rate | Avg failures |
|---|---|---|---|
| Petrol (92%) | 23,318 | 69.6% | 4.28 |
| Diesel (8%) | 1,972 | 69.6% | 4.42 |

2001 Peugeot 106 — Still on the Road
Numbers are thinning — 5% of 2001 Peugeot 106s are still active.
Numbers are declining — 739 vehicles still getting MOTs in 2025 (5% of peak).
Based on vehicles from this manufacture year that had at least one MOT test in each calendar year. Data from 2014–2025.
* The 2020 dip reflects the government's COVID-19 MOT exemption, which allowed certificates to be extended by six months — fewer tests were conducted that year.
